Preheat oven to 400 degrees and grease a 12-cup muffin pan with nonstick cooking spray.
In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cornstarch,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Set aside.
In a separate bowl, beat together the sugar, brown sugar, and oil until smooth and well combined. Add the eggs one at a time, beating between each addition.
Beat in the milk and vanilla.
Add the dry ingredients and mix until smooth.
Fold in the mini chocolate chips and sprinkles until well mixed.
Fill each cup of the muffin pan 2/3 of the way full. Sprinkle additional chocolate chips and sprinkles on top of each muffin, if desired.
Bake in the preheated oven for 18 to 20 minutes, until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
Allow to cool in the pan until safe to touch, then transfer the muffins to a wire cooling rack to cool completely before serving.
- Mix the batter as little as possible. I always slowly add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and gently fold them together until just combined. I learned that over-mixing can make muffins dense and tough, so now I take my time and keep it light, it’s the key to getting that fluffy, moist texture everyone loves!
- I always mix the wet and dry ingredients in separate bowls first. It makes combining everything easier and ensures the batter comes out just right.
- I use a measuring cup or ice cream scoop to fill the muffin liners evenly. It’s the best way to get muffins that bake perfectly every time.
- Spraying the muffin liners with non-stick cooking spray is a must. It keeps the muffins from sticking and makes them so much easier to remove.
- I always make sure my oven is fully preheated before baking. It helps the muffins rise properly and bake evenly.
